Specifications

Material:FR-4 TG150
Board Thickness:1.6mm
Layers:2
Copper Thickness:1OZ
Surface Treatment:Lead Free-HASL
Solder Mask:Green
Silkscreen:White

Reliable USB Connector PCB Assembly

For USB interface products, connector stability directly affects product performance. Repeated insertion and removal can place higher requirements on soldering quality and connector assembly accuracy.
